CompFox AI Summary

The Workers' Compensation Appeals Board granted reconsideration of the WCJ's January 3, 2013 decision in the case of Mirian Merino v. Almore Dye House, Inc. and Employers Compensation Insurance Company. The Board rescinded the WCJ's decision and remanded the case back to the trial level for further proceedings and a new decision. This action is not a final determination on the merits of the claims.
